响应式网站设计通过灵活的布局、媒体查询和优化技术,确保网站在不同设备上自动适应并提供一致的用户体验。
核心原则
- 内容优先级与结构化:合理规划网站内容结构,确保关键信息在不同设备上都能迅速找到。
- 流式布局:避免使用固定宽度的布局,而是通过百分比或相对单位来设置页面元素的宽度和间距,使页面内容在不同设备上保持流畅展示。
- 媒体查询:使用CSS媒体查询,根据不同屏幕尺寸调整网站布局和样式。
- 弹性图片技术:保证图片在不同设备上保持清晰,避免加载失败。
实施步骤
- 信息架构设计:合理规划网站内容结构,确保关键信息在不同设备上都能迅速找到。
- 使用响应式框架:选择合适的响应式框架,如Bootstrap、Foundation等,提高开发效率。
- 优化图片:压缩图片,减小文件大小;使用CSS背景图片或SVG图片,保证图片在不同设备上清晰展示。
- 合并文件:合并CSS和JavaScript文件,减少HTTP请求,提高页面加载速度。
- 利用浏览器缓存:设置合理的缓存策略,提高页面加载速度。
- 调整导航栏:根据设备类型,调整导航栏的显示方式,方便用户操作。
- 优化按钮和链接:优化按钮和链接的尺寸,方便用户触摸操作。
- 简化导航结构:针对移动设备,简化导航结构,提高用户触摸操作的便捷性。
性能优化
- 监控网站性能:建立持续的性能监控体系,确保系统始终保持最优状态。
- 定期进行性能测试:定期对网站进行性能测试,确保在不同设备上都能提供良好的浏览体验。
- 优化加载速度:针对移动设备进行性能调优,以提供流畅的交互体验。
测试与验证
- 多设备测试:在设计过程中,务必在不同的设备上测试网站的显示效果,确保其在不同设备上都能正常显示。
- 用户反馈:收集用户反馈,根据用户需求不断优化网站设计和功能。
实际案例
某电商网站采用响应式设计后,移动设备访问量提升了30%,用户停留时间增加了20%。某企业网站采用简化导航结构后,移动设备用户转化率提升了15%。某新闻网站采用优化加载速度后,移动设备访问量提升了25%,用户流失率降低了10%。
通过实施上述优化策略,响应式网站在特定环境下的性能和用户体验得到了显著提升,为企业带来了更高的流量和转化率。